logo

Output e8713ac395fc77113252ba5a72a62a8e06f9ae467648ab240e68b7f490ef8f37:3

value
28850662
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28e8215a8d01908acc4154db98e2663c5d6c1076 OP_EQUALVERIFY OP_CHECKSIG
address
14jJ7NNE2CRep6XGEBEeVNhjZKJbo4CcuY
transaction
e8713ac395fc77113252ba5a72a62a8e06f9ae467648ab240e68b7f490ef8f37